{"id":24403,"date":"2026-07-01T13:16:34","date_gmt":"2026-07-01T17:16:34","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/plq.org\/?p=24403"},"modified":"2026-08-31T15:11:06","modified_gmt":"2026-08-31T19:11:06","slug":"isabelle-sabourin-candidate-officielle-du-parti-liberal-du-quebec-dans-papineau","status":"publish","type":"communique","link":"https:\/\/plq.org\/en\/communique\/isabelle-sabourin-candidate-officielle-du-parti-liberal-du-quebec-dans-papineau\/","title":{"rendered":"Isabelle Sabourin, candidate officielle du Parti lib\u00e9ral du Qu\u00e9bec dans Papineau"},"content":{"rendered":"<p class=\"font-claude-response-body break-words whitespace-normal\">Ripon, June 22, 2026 \u2014 In the presence of Quebec Liberal Party leader Charles Milliard and local party activists, Ms. Isabelle Sabourin was officially nominated as the Quebec Liberal Party\u2019s candidate in the Papineau riding.<\/p>\n<p class=\"font-claude-response-body break-words whitespace-normal\">Passionate about regional development and deeply committed to the Outaouais region, Isabelle Sabourin has dedicated her career for more than 20 years to advancing the interests of her region. Her knowledge of local conditions, particularly in rural areas, has enabled her to develop a nuanced understanding of the challenges and opportunities that shape community development.<\/p>\n<p class=\"font-claude-response-body break-words whitespace-normal\">Throughout her career, she has held strategic positions at the municipal, provincial, and federal levels. Since 2021, she has served as Director of Strategic and Regional Issues in the office of Canada\u2019s Minister of Transport and as the Government Leader in the House of Commons. She has also served as a policy advisor to the National Assembly of Quebec and as a territorial director for the City of Gatineau\u2014experiences that have allowed her to work closely with municipalities, community organizations, and economic stakeholders in the region.<\/p>\n<p class=\"font-claude-response-body break-words whitespace-normal\">A graduate in social sciences from the Universit\u00e9 du Qu\u00e9bec en Outaouais, she went on to pursue graduate studies in regional development and change management. Deeply committed to her community, she is actively involved with the Breakfast Clubs and the Ripon Trad Festival, among other organizations, and has contributed to several initiatives related to health, youth, and higher education.<\/p>\n<p class=\"font-claude-response-body break-words whitespace-normal\">Deeply committed to Papineau, Isabelle Sabourin now hopes to put her experience to work for the citizens of the riding.
